Vietnam to receive mRNA vaccine technology from WHO

Vietnam to receive mRNA vaccine technology from WHO

The World Health Organization (WHO) announced on February 23 that Vietnam, Bangladesh, Indonesia, Pakistan, and Serbia will receive mRNA technology from its mRNA technology transfer center. Addressing the online announcement ceremony, Minister of Health Nguyen Thanh Long said that Vietnam will produce mRNA vaccines on a large scale, not only meeting domestic demand but also supplying countries in the region and the world.

Transport looks to go green

Transport looks to go green

Vietnam’s transportation sector is developing an action program on green energy transition, reducing carbon emissions under the commitment the country made at the UN Climate Change Conference of the Parties (COP26) to gradually reduce net emissions to “zero” by 2050. Road, railway, inland waterway, maritime, and aviation transport all use fossil fuels and add to emissions.

MoF calls for further relief for businesses and people

MoF calls for further relief for businesses and people

After two years of Covid-19, support for businesses and individuals in regard to taxes, fees, and land rentals has totaled VND328 trillion ($14.4 billion). To continue cutting outlays, the Ministry of Finance (MoF) has proposed the government reduce 37 fees and charges this year.
